Details
POTTER, Beatrix (1866-1943). The Tale of Jemima Puddleduck. London: Frederick Warne, 1908.

Presentation copy, signed and poetically inscribed by the author on the front free endpaper: “To Mr. Dixon of Howe End, these curious happenings amongst the foxgloves in Bishop’s Wood are presented by the author / with kind regards from Beatrix Heelis.” Linder, p. 427; Quinby 14.

12mo. Color frontispiece and 26 color plates by Beatrix Potter. Original green boards with pictorial cover label, pictorial endpapers (light wear to extremities, sunning, short edge-tear to f.f.e. touching illustration). Custom cloth chemise, slipcase. Provenance: Mr. Dixon (presentation inscription) – Doris Frohnsdorff (her sale, Christie’s East, 16 April 1997, lot 71).
